Research of natural gas engine is produced by shortage of energy and problem of environmental pollution day by day in the world. The natural gas is a kind of economic fuel, there are abundant natural gas resources in our country, developing the natural gas engine can fully utilize domestic resources and reduce the reliance on the international energy market, natural gas engine has a bright future. It becomes an important subject that electronic control system of natural gas engine is researched. The traditional electronic control system uses MCU and computer together which has a low speed and poor real-time character. With the fast development of digital signal processor, DSPs are playing an important role in making the performance ofthe electronic control system more perfect-high speed, low power consumptionand good real-time instead of MCU. This system is just one of natural gas engine electronic control system based on DSP.System of this thesis design adopts DSP controller as hardware core, hardware system gathers by signal module, man machine interface module and power module. Signal module mainly sends speed and temperature signal to DSP controller after amplifying and shaping;man machine interface module mainly realizes display and fault alarm function;power module offers the power that the system needs.Expect much to those performance or precision, real-time character is strong, small, embedded occasion, it may be a kind of implementation method with higher performance-cost ratio to motion control on the basis of DSP controller. The systemmainly consists of DSP------the control core, into which we move the advancedfuzzy control algorithm, advanced channels, executive parts, man-machine interfaces and power etc. It is a stable and high reliable negative feedback system which can control the ignition moment and energy of the natural gas engine to generate electricity.This paper introduces the primary principle of the natural gas engine control system, puts forward a whole design idea, and gives the system structure . It still introduces the central control part of the system and important peripheral circuits and discusses the fuzzy control algorithm, software design and the realization on the hardware platform.The system selects the popular digital signal processor DSP-TMS320LF2407 as the control center. This chip is one of the c2000 products apt to. industry control produced by American TI company whose products are 44% of thetotal DSP products in the world. It has low power consumption, high executivespeed, strong real-time control ability, and includes 41 I/O interfaces,2K RAM,2.5KRAM,DARAM,32K FLASH and A/D functional parts. This paper compares DSP with MCU, analyses the advantage of the DSP such as buses structure, pipelines and repeated operations, and introduces the CPU and memory structure of TMS320LF2407 in detail.The system still includes control scheme and programming. Control inflow of air and natural gas according to the speed and temperature of the natural gas engine, make abundant burning, in order to make speed to be invariable, improve power performance, at the same time, can reduce pollution. This thesis foundation speed change, speed rate of change and temperature change design three input two output fuzzy controller, adopting fuzzy control algorithms, through simulation of the system, the fuzzy controllers designed can reach very good result.The obvious advantages of the fuzzy controller control rules do not receive any restraint, can not be totally analyzed, benefit to discuss and revise with the operator with practical experience together, adopt various kinds of good control thoughts. Using the computer to realize fuzzy control, it is convenient for people to adopt the natural language to exert one's influence on plant. In addition, this kind of control rule has very great currency, can be suitable for many kinds of different plant through small modification.The software includes init module, starting module, gathering module, control module and man-machine interfaces module.The whole control system is consisted of all the above.The DSP technology is getting a rapid development now, and has been applied to fields of information processing,communication and industry control extensively.
